Astrocytes are responsible for:
A
producing cerebrospinal fluid
B
creating the blood brain barrier
C
producing myelin sheath
D
destroying cancer cells
Explanation: 

Detailed explanation-1: -Astrocytes are essential for the formation and maintenance of the BBB by providing secreted factors that lead to the adequate association between the cells of the BBB and the formation of strong tight junctions.

Detailed explanation-2: -Astrocytes not only regulate blood flow, but also transfer mitochondria to neurons, and supply the building blocks of neurotransmitters, which fuel neuronal metabolism [2, 11, 57]. In addition, astrocytes can phagocytose synapses, alter neurotrophin secretion, and clear debris [14, 58].
